## Encoding Detection for Uploads

When your plugin receives a text file through the Larkmont ingest pipeline, do not assume UTF-8. Call the detection endpoint first: it samples the initial 64 KB, checks for BOMs, and falls back to statistical charset inference. Plugins that skip detection frequently corrupt legacy Shift-variant files from regional partners, so the validator will reject undetected uploads. To exercise the detection endpoint in the sandbox, authenticate against the internal charset service using the key below.

gateway credential: kto3_qfe

## Session Handling — Blue-Green

Tallowbill's billing worker drains sessions before cutover. Green pool refuses new sessions once Switchlane flags it; blue finishes in-flight invoices (max 10 min). Sticky session keys survive the flip via the Marrowgate cache. Verify drain status before promoting. To call the drain-status endpoint during the release window, send the credential below.

portal login ticket: eyJhbGciOiJIUzI1NiIsInR5cCI6IkpXVCJ9.eyJzdWIiOiI0Z4ywpUMsBIn0.ca5FVhkdBXa3

- [ ] **Step 7: Breaker override escrow.** After sealing the signing keys for the Tallgrove upstream API circuit breaker, confirm the support team can force the breaker open during a full outage. The override bundle lives in the sealed escrow drawer and is useless without its unlock phrase. Two ceremony witnesses must initial this step before proceeding. The escrow bundle is decrypted with the recovery passphrase that follows.

vault phrase of kahip-kahop = holath-quenmir

[ ] Clock skew check — support escalations. Before signing off the Bramlow release, confirm build agents in the Osprey pool are within 200ms of the fleet NTP source; skew beyond that produces the "artifact newer than signature" errors customers have been reporting. If a ticket mentions timestamp mismatches, ask for the agent pool name first. Agents passing the skew check are stamped with the identifier that appears below.

trace token, kahog-tajeg: htk6_97d963